Schools Cutting Carbon Large Grant Opportunity

The Minnesota Pollution Control Agency (MPCA) has issued a grant Request for Proposals (RFP) to all Minnesota Schools Cutting Carbon (MnSCC) schools.

 
This grant opportunity is now closed. Thanks to all of the schools who submitted applications. Winners will be announced early in 2010.

Details: Under this RFP, the MPCA will award between 10 and 15 grants of up to $20,000 for projects that will reduce the carbon footprints of MnSCC schools and involve students in a leadership role. These grants are available only to MnSCC schools.
